It’s that time of year when the beach population soars, visitors and locals pack the city for festivals and activities, and we all partake in picnics or delicious take-out from our fine restaurants. While we can do our best to promote “pack out what you pack in”, and we love to keep our city beautiful, all the trash that is generated could pile up.

You can use the City of Vancouver’s VanConnect App to not only report overflowing litter cans in parks and on City streets this season, but you can also use the app to report abandoned garbage throughout the year.

Put Garbage in its Place with the VanConnect App

The free app can be downloaded for Android and iOS, and Blackberry at any time.

You can report all kinds of issues on the VanConnect App, from graffiti to broken street lights and litter, all on the go from the palm of your hand. Abandoned mattress in the alley? Snap a photo and report it for cleanup. You can also find out when to water your lawn, upcoming road closures, and the latest news.

VanConnect App Screenshots

Once you have the app open, click on the Submit Service Request button right in the centre. Garbage & Litter, then select the type.

For abandoned garbage, you can report appliances, donation bin cleanup, electronic waste, furniture, garbage and miscellaneous junk, mattresses/box springs. The next step is to pin point the location on a map, add a photo (optional), fill in a few more location details and submit.

Adults throughout the province can feel like a kid again when they enjoy an Adult Pirate Pak to support White Spot’s 9th annual Pirate Pak Day charity initiative. For each Pirate Pak sold on August 15th, White Spot will donate $2.00 to Zajac Ranch for Children, an established BC charity that provides a once-in-a-lifetime summer camp experience to kids and young adults with life-threatening illnesses and chronic disabilities.

Pirate Pak Day at White Spot

Pirate Pak Day

The Pirate Pak is a legendary favourite that has been enjoyed by millions since 1968. The Pirate Pak was first created by Nat Bailey in 1968 to provide an exclusive dining experience for kids age 10 and under. This year the Pirate Pak celebrates its 50th birthday!

On August 15th, the Adult Pirate Pak Day menu will be available for dine-in and takeout. The menu includes a selection of the famous burgers (Legendary, BC Chicken, Bacon Cheddar and Veggie), sandwiches and more. All are served in the iconic Pirate boat, and complete with “endless” Kennebec fries, creamy coleslaw, a soft drink, a scoop of premium rich ice cream and a chocolate “gold” coin. View the full Pirate Pak Day menu for adults here »

BONUS! For every sleeve or pint of any one of our craft beers on draught, or any glass of wine from the 100% VQA wine list, White Spot’s partners will donate 25¢ to Zajac Ranch.

Almost a million Pirate Paks were sold last year (54,064 of them were on Pirate Pak Day alone). To date, White Spot has raised a total of more than $660,000 for Zajac Ranch for Children and sent more than 400 kids to camp.

White Spot will be sending kids to Zajac Ranch for “White Spot Week” from August 20 to 23. The kids will participate in a variety of activities such as horseback riding, kayaking, water sports and arts and crafts – an opportunity that wouldn’t otherwise be possible.

It’s the stargazing highlight of the entire summer season, and the Perseid Meteor Shower peaks this week! Probably the most well-known of all the yearly meteor showers, the Weather Network has shared two things that make the Perseid Meteor Shower particularly spectacular:

Perseid Meteor Shower

Perseid Meteor Shower

1) It is one of only three yearly meteor showers where its possible to see up to 100 meteors per hour (the other two are in autumn and winter), and

2) the Perseids produce the greatest number of bright fireball meteors, compared to every other meteor shower we know.

Right now, Earth is passing through a wide stream of meteoroids in space – small bits of ice, dust and rock orbiting the Sun, after being left behind by the passage of a massive ball of ice, dust and rock, known as Comet 109P/Swift-Tuttle.

When these meteoroids encounter Earth’s atmosphere, they streak through the sky, producing bright flashes of light that we call the Perseid Meteor Shower.

Where to Watch the Perseid Meteor Shower

The shower actually runs from July 17 to August 24, as it takes over a month for Earth to completely traverse the width of the meteoroid stream left behind by Comet Swift-Tuttle. The peak will be August 12-13, and the best time to watch!
